Queen Elizabeth II gets BlackBerry to PIN Subjects

July 5, 2010 by Simon Sage - 1 Comment

Share on Twitter Share on Facebook ( 0 shares )

While visiting Canada for our national holiday on the 1st., Queen Elizabeth II swung by Waterloo to visit our country’s most successful company, Research in Motion. She got a white BlackBerry Bold 9700, and stayed at the RIM assembling facilities for less than a half hour. The Queen’s not the first one in the royal family to nab a BlackBerry, though – Prince Charles picked up a Storm 9520 in January, and apparently Prince Andrew is a big fan of BlackBerry. . More power to Queen Elizabeth II if she can figure the thing out, but I have a feeling she has more than enough support to handle her e-mails.  As is, there’s a Twitter account for the British Monarchy, but we probably won’t see Her Majesty tweeting anytime soon.
